Comprehending ADHD
Before diving into online tests, it’s vital to comprehend ADHD. The disorder is acknowledged in three predominant discussions:
| Presentation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Primarily Inattentive | Symptoms mainly include trouble sustaining attention, lapse of memory, and disorganization. |
| Primarily Hyperactive | Symptoms generally involve excessive fidgeting, talkativeness, and impulsiveness. |
| Integrated Presentation | A mix of both inattentive and hyperactive-impulsive symptoms. |
Individuals with ADHD may display a range of symptoms, and these can manifest in a different way across age, genders, and environments.
The Free Online ADHD Test: What is it?
An ADHD test is created to determine your symptoms and habits to highlight potential indications of ADHD. Free online tests usually include a series of questions that examine various aspects of inattention and hyperactivity-impulsivity. They provide a preliminary evaluation, which can help individuals determine whether they should seek additional professional assessment.
Structure of an Online ADHD Test
Normally, these tests contain multiple-choice questions where respondents rate their experiences. A typical structure might consist of:
| Question | Scale |
|---|---|
| How frequently do you struggle to follow in-depth directions? | Never (0) – Rarely (1) – Sometimes (2) – Often (3) – Very Often (4 ) |
| How often do you feel restless or fidgety? | Never Ever (0) – Rarely (1) – Sometimes (2) – Often (3) – Very Often (4 ) |
Responses are scored to provide a total sign of ADHD tendencies.
How Accurate Are These Tests?
While free online ADHD tests can supply important insights, it is essential to comprehend that they are not diagnostic tools. Their accuracy can vary substantially based on the test style and questions. Expert assessments involve standardized assessments and medical interviews, which take a more holistic view of the person’s behavior and history.
Limitations of Online ADHD Tests
| Restriction | Explanation |
|---|---|
| Not Diagnostic | Outcomes do not verify ADHD and must not replace expert evaluations. |
| Concern Bias | Personal understanding of symptoms can differ, leading to diverse interpretations of concerns. |
| Health Conditions Overlap | Other conditions might simulate ADHD symptoms, making complex the analysis of test results. |
| Lack of Contextual Information | Tests may not capture environmental factors or co-occurring mental health conditions. |

FAQs about Online ADHD Tests
1. Are online ADHD tests reliable?
While they can use insights, online tests are not sure-fire. They ought to be considered as starting points instead of conclusive evaluations.
2. Can I take these tests free of charge?
Yes, various platforms provide Free Online ADHD Test online ADHD tests. Search for those constructed by trusted organizations for accuracy.
3. What should I do if the test recommends I have ADHD?
Take the outcomes seriously but understand that a diagnosis requires a thorough assessment by a healthcare expert. Set up an assessment to discuss your findings.
4. Do kids have different ADHD tests?
Yes, tests for kids may focus on developmental milestones and include observations from moms and dads and instructors.
5. Can adults develop ADHD?
ADHD is frequently detected in childhood, however symptoms can continue into their adult years, or in many cases, it might not be acknowledged up until later on.
